Mechanical Properties: High in all strength properties except stiffness which is medium. It has a very good steam bending classification. Working Properties: A difficult wood to work with a moderate blunting of cutting edges. A reduced cutting angle is required with wavy or curly grained material. Pre-bore for nailing or screwing, takes glue stain and polish satisfactorily. Red maple is closely related to silver/big leaf maples with a similar color and grain pattern. How to Choose the Right Type of Maple Veneer for Your Needs https://youtu.be/pSVGHneNoPs Video can’t be loaded because JavaScript is disabled: Maple Veneer Hanging Lamp (https://youtu.be/pSVGHneNoPs)General Description: Cream-white with a reddish tinge. Large trees may have dark drown heart. Usually straight grained but sometimes curly or wavy. Fine brown lines give an attractive growth ring figure on plain sawn surfaces. Texture is fine and even. Weight average about 720 kg/m³ (45 1b/ft³); specific gravity .72.
